RFID Tracking Systems

One of the key technologies that hospitals are using to improve their supply and equipment management systems is RFID (Radio Frequency Identification) tracking systems. RFID technology allows hospitals to track the location of medical equipment, supplies, and even patients in real-time. By tagging each item with an RFID tag, hospitals can monitor their inventory levels, prevent loss or theft, and improve the overall efficiency of their operations.

Automated Inventory Management Systems

Another smart home technology that hospitals are adopting is automated inventory management systems. These systems use cutting-edge software to track and manage inventory levels, reorder supplies when needed, and optimize storage space. By automating the inventory management process, hospitals can reduce the risk of stockouts, minimize waste, and streamline their Supply Chain operations.

Predictive Analytics Tools

In addition to RFID tracking systems and automated inventory management systems, hospitals are also leveraging predictive analytics tools to forecast demand, optimize inventory levels, and improve Supply Chain efficiency. These tools use advanced algorithms to analyze historical data, identify trends, and make accurate predictions about future supply and equipment needs.
